Architectural design optimization (ADO) is a subfield of engineering that uses optimization methods to study, aid, and solve architectural design problems, such as optimal floorplan layout design, optimal circulation paths between rooms, sustainability and the like.

Facility condition assessment is an analysis of the condition of a facility in terms of age, design, construction methods, and materials. [1] [2] The individuals who perform the assessment are typically architects and engineers, and skilled-trade technicians.
Architectural analytics is a field of study focused on discovering and identifying meaningful patterns within architecture.Architectural analytics can include the systematic study of the elements and principles that constitute a building or structure, such as form, function, space planning, materials, technology, and cultural context, to understand its design, function, and cultural significance.

Utility-based probability maximization was developed in response to some logical concerns (e.g., Blau's Dilemma) with reliability-based design optimization. [4] This approach focuses on maximizing the joint probability of both the objective function exceeding some value and of all the constraints being satisfied.
